The Science Behind Fall Colors

As we approach the time of year when everyone starts searching for the brilliant colors of autumn, it’s a perfect opportunity to explore how nature produces these breathtaking hues.
The Hidden Colors of Leaves
Most of the vibrant colors we see in fall have been present in the leaves all year long. However, they are hidden beneath the dominant green shade created by chlorophyll. Chlorophyll is a green pigment found in all green plants. Its primary role is to absorb light and provide the energy needed for photosynthesis, the process that allows plants to make food from sunlight.
Why Leaves Are Green in Spring and Summer
During the spring and summer, days are longer and there is more sunlight. This abundance of sunlight prompts trees and plants to produce large amounts of chlorophyll. As a result, the green color of chlorophyll dominates the appearance of the leaves, masking the other colors.
The Arrival of Fall Colors
When the days begin to shorten and temperatures drop in the fall, trees produce less chlorophyll. As chlorophyll production slows and eventually stops, the green pigment fades away. This process reveals the leaves’ natural colors, which had been hidden throughout the warmer months. Ultimately, when there is no more chlorophyll, the leaves die and fall from the trees.
Nature’s Grand Finale
This seasonal transformation offers us a spectacular view of the trees’ “true colors.” It’s as if the trees wear green costumes for half the year, and in autumn, they briefly reveal their real appearance. After the leaves fall, the trees stand bare through the winter, and the cycle of photosynthesis begins anew in the spring. Nature’s process is truly amazing, offering us this colorful display each year.
